Tejas Trail Mix

This is so good! Even my kids love it! A little sweet, a little spicy & nutty! (From Tejas restaurant in Edina, MN, recipe found on the startribune website)

SERVES 24 , 1/4 cup (change servings and units)

Ingredients

Directions

  1. 1
    Preheat oven to 375 degrees. Toast each type of nut separately, 10 to 15 minutes until they are fragrant and have begun to color; time will vary depending on nut size and oil content. In a large bowl combine toasted nuts with both kinds of raisins.
  2. 2
    In a small bowl, combine kosher salt, cayenne pepper, cumin and molasses. Mix into nut mixture. Store in refrigerator.
